Guidance and manufacturer’s declaration - electromagnetic immunity
The TotalAlert Embedded control system is intended for use in the electromagnetic environment specifi ed
below. The customer or the user of the TotalAlert Embedded control system should assure that it is used in such
an environment.

Electrostatic
Discharge (ESD)
IEC 61000-4-2
±6 kV contact
±8 kV air
±6 kV contact
±8 kV air
Floors should be wood, concrete or ceramic tile.
If fl oors are covered with synthetic material, the
relative humidity should be at least 30 %.
